In the digital media landscape, what we see online is mostly elected by algorithms which are shaped by our online behaviours. Each social media channel utilizes its own automated system to reveal more info new content and suggest material that will interest the user. The types of media content examples that will be revealed to a user is developed to keep users engaged. The algorithms are designed to keep people stimulated by suggesting and boosting videos that are relevant, well-liked or controversial among other users. While this level of personalisation can be practical, it can limit the areas of media that individuals are subjected to, developing more segmentation and prejudice among users around social issues. In today day, online platforms have made it significantly much easier for everyone to develop and distribute material. Previously, producing content for a broad audience required access to a series of essential resources and financing. Currently, with using smartphones and typical digital innovations, digital media content examples such as short form videos, website posts and podcasts can be easily created with simply a few standard gadgets, as well as reaching a huge audience, very rapidly. This has opened the door for more diverse voices, especially those who were previously ignored by mainstream media. The rise of internet content has completely changed what is suggested by the term mass media. In the past, mass media followed a hierarchical arrangement, using a top-down media model. Generally, a small group of professionals, such as newspaper editors or broadcasters, who would develop content for large audiences who mainly just consumed it. Nevertheless, at present, with the aid of the web, the face of media has seen considerable change, making the consumption and ease of access of media far more open and interactive. With access to popular social media platforms, new media examples are showing that people can develop and share their own material, just as quickly as they can absorb it. Social media has enabled anybody to contribute to public conversations, instead of simply the major media firms therefore as a result, mass media is no longer controlled by a couple of big voices. Rather, it is spread across millions of user stories around the globe.
